Top Roof Solutions: Kinds of Materials and Their Advantages

Roofing materials play an essential role in the overall durability and lifespan of a home. Multiple roofing material options exist, each offering unique benefits tailored to specific needs. Asphalt shingles are favored for their affordability and ease of installation, providing reliable protection against the elements. Metal roofing stands out for its durability and energy efficiency, often lasting longer than traditional materials. Clay and concrete tiles offer a distinctive aesthetic and superior heat management, making them suitable for warmer climates.

Wood shakes or shingles, while demanding additional upkeep, showcase a natural look and superior insulation. Also, engineered materials, such as composite or rubber shingles, unite the appearance of standard options with superior durability and minimal maintenance needs. All materials offer unique strengths, enabling homeowners to opt based on budget, climate, and visual preferences, which aids in maintaining the home's structural integrity and property value.

Recognizing Regular Roofing Challenges and Their Remedies

Common roof issues can significantly affect the integrity of a home. Among the most frequently encountered problems are water seepage, which can arise from broken shingles, improper flashing, or deteriorated sealants. Identifying these leaks early is essential, as they can cause extensive water damage if not addressed. Another common issue is the presence of moss and algae, which can compromise the roof's appearance and durability. Frequently cleaning the roof can reduce this problem.

Additionally, cracked or missing roofing tiles are signs of deterioration often necessitating replacement to preserve defense against the elements. Inadequate ventilation can also result in heat buildup, resulting in early deterioration of roofing materials. Property owners are advised to conduct routine checks and consult professional roofers for fixes tailored to particular problems. Timely identification and correction of these common problems can considerably extend a roof's lifespan and protect the home's overall structure.

Consistent Inspections Hold Significance

Regular inspections play a crucial role in extending the lifespan of a roof. By identifying potential issues early, homeowners can prevent minor problems from escalating into significant damage. A thorough inspection typically includes inspecting for absent shingles, evaluating flashing integrity, and inspecting gutters for accumulated debris. These evaluations allow for prompt action, ensuring that the roof stays waterproof and structurally intact. Furthermore, periodic checks can help adjust upkeep plans based on shifting climate patterns, which may affect roof functionality. Establishing a regular inspection schedule, ideally twice a year, empowers homeowners to stay proactive about roof care. This attention to detail not only improves the roof's longevity but also contributes to the overall value of the property, making it a smart financial choice.

Frequently Asked Questions

How Long Does a Standard Roofing Project Take to Complete?

A typical roofing project generally takes one to two weeks to complete, based on various factors such as the size of the roof, type of material, weather conditions, and any unexpected issues that may arise during the process.

Which Warranties Are Available for Roof Installation?

Roofing service warranties typically offer workmanship warranties detailed article ranging from one to ten years and material warranties lasting up to 50 years. The particulars often depend on the roofing materials used and the service provider's guidelines.

Is a Authorization Necessary for Roofing Work?

Yes, a authorization is typically required for roofing work, according to local regulations and the scale of the project. Homeowners should contact their local authorities to guarantee adherence to necessary building codes and permits.
